The movie “Adhe Neram Adhe Idam” was released on August 12, 2022, and within hours, the film was leaked on Tamilrockers. The pirated version of the movie was made available for download on the website, allowing users to access the film without paying for it.

According to a report by the International Federation of the Phonographic Industry (IFPI), piracy costs the Indian film industry millions of dollars in lost revenue every year. The report also notes that piracy has a ripple effect on the entire entertainment ecosystem, impacting not just filmmakers but also distributors, exhibitors, and other stakeholders.

The leak of the movie on Tamilrockers has sparked outrage among fans, critics, and the film’s makers. The movie’s producers have issued a statement condemning the piracy and urging fans to watch the film through legitimate channels.

Downloading pirated content from websites like Tamilrockers poses significant risks to users. Pirated files often contain malware, viruses, and other malicious software that can compromise users’ devices and personal data.
